Judge Breaks Silence After Alleged Draft Of His Judgment In Favour Wike-Backed Lawmakers Leaked

Justice D. U. Okorowo has broken his silence after an alleged draft of his judgment in favour of Nyesom Wike-backed lawmakers leaked.

A draft of an alleged judgment by the Judge at the Federal High Court Abuja had leaked earlier. According to the document, Justice Okorowo had given a ruling favouring the Wike-backed lawmakers of Rivers State House of Assembly who recently dumped the Peoples Democratic Party, PDP, and joined the All Progressives Congress, APC.

Recall that the Rivers State High Court sitting in Port Harcourt which was presided over by Justice D.M. Danagogo, had restrained factional Speaker, Martin Amaewhule, from interfering and disrupting the activities of the House of Assembly Speaker, Edison Ehie, from carrying out his legislative functions.

The court gave the order on Tuesday while ruling in a motion ex parte filed by the Rivers State House of Assembly and Edison Ehie as claimants/applicants in a suit marked PHC/3030/CS/2023, with Martin Amaewhule and Duule Maol as defendants.

However, if it scales through, the draft judgement that leaked on Sunday will stop the declaration of the seats of the 27 lawmakers as vacant and give them a backing to start the impeachment proceedings against Governor Siminalyi Fubara by Tuesday. Fubara has been having political clash with his predecessor and Minister of the FCT, Wike.

Speaking on the leaked judgment, Justice Okorowo debunked the allegation calling the document fake.

He told Sahara Reporters to “Verify your facts right; it is no true,”.

Meanwhile, the leaked judgment has been generating mixed reactions from members of the public amid controversy.
